** The Volvo repair market for Corning, Iowa, residents is characterized by a need to travel to the Des Moines metropolitan area for specialized service. There are no Volvo-specific specialists located directly in Corning. The market in Des Moines is moderately competitive with a clear tier structure. The official Volvo retailer offers the pinnacle of factory-backed service, software, and calibration tools, particularly for newer models, hybrid/electric vehicles, and complex safety systems, but at a premium price. Independent specialists like Swedish Auto Service provide a high level of brand-specific expertise, often with more personalized service and lower labor rates, making them an excellent choice for older and out-of-warranty models. General European auto shops offer a viable third option for standard repairs and maintenance. Typical pricing follows this hierarchy, with dealerships being the most expensive, followed by brand-specific independents, and then general European specialists.

Common questions about volvo repair services in Corning, IA
In Corning, you'll want to seek out independent shops with certified European car technicians, as there is no dedicated Volvo dealership nearby. Verify expertise by asking about their specific training, diagnostic equipment for Volvo models, and experience with common issues like electronic module failures.
Given Iowa's seasonal extremes, common issues include aging suspension components from rough rural roads and battery/charging system stress from cold winters. Older Volvo models in the area also frequently need attention for oil leaks and worn front-wheel-drive components like CV axles.
Volvo repair costs in Corning are generally higher due to specialized parts and labor, but using a trusted local independent shop can be more affordable than a distant dealership. Always request a detailed estimate upfront, as parts often need to be ordered, which can add time but allows for price transparency.
Seek service immediately for critical warnings like the red temperature or oil light, especially before long drives on highways like US-34. For less urgent lights, schedule a diagnostic scan promptly at a local shop with Volvo-compatible software to prevent a minor issue from becoming a major, costly repair.
Yes, prepare your Volvo for Iowa's harsh winters by ensuring the block heater and AWD system (if equipped) are serviced. Also, due to Corning's rural location, build a relationship with a local shop for priority service and consider proactive maintenance on wear items like tires and brakes due to gravel road driving.
